After the MC5 broke up in late 1972, Fred "Sonic" Smith took some time to dry out, because most of the guys in the band had some kind of drug habit going at the time.  Once he was done, he put together a band called Ascension, which consisted of him on guitar, Michael Davis from the 5 on vocals, Dennis Thompson on drums, and an unknown on bass. They played a total of ten gigs, and this was one of them. It was inside some Detroit bowling alley. It's a sounboard recording where an audio jack was shorting out, which you'll hear on "Shakin' Street."
